Although this book was a little cheesy at times, it had an amazing message about the challenges that come with loving (and sometimes hating) your family. I enjoyed the change in narration in both the twins and the time. I fell in love with both Noah and Jude. It was beautiful to watch the twins' relationship evolve from the beginning to the end and I appreciated that it wasn't all about a teenage love story.
Overall, "I'll Give You The Sun" is amazingly well written and it resonated with me on a deeper level. I would happily recommend this book to my students.
